Abstract
The present invention relates to magnetic approach switch technical field, refer specifically to a kind of low-pressure injection molding magnetic approach switch, it is the glue box that opening is set including upper end, tongue tube and disengaging lead, the right end wall of the glue box is equipped with two threading grooves, it is equipped with solidus buckle on the inside of the left end walls of glue box, the side wall of solidus buckle and glue box cooperatively forms solidus mouth;The disengaging lead is electrically connected with two pins of tongue tube respectively, and the one of pin of tongue tube is fixedly arranged in solidus mouth, and disengaging lead is extended laterally away out of corresponding threading groove respectively;The present invention is rational in infrastructure, and tongue tube pin is stablized with lead by rivet integrally connected, electrical connection intensity high-performance;The rivet of tongue tube one end is arranged in solidus mouth, the position restriction that the tongue tube other end passes through line hole and floor, rigging position of the tongue tube in glue box inner cavity is rationally realized low pressure injection formaing technique, the impact strength and electric stability of tongue tube can be effectively improved.

Background technology
Dry-reed magnetic approach switch is the break-make between a kind of achievable two contacts of non-contact magnetic force triggering tongue tube
Controlling switch, its reliability is fully verified, is widely used as safety con-trol part.And tongue tube belongs to
Frangible glass tubing products, manufacture and transportational process in be easier that breakage causes switch failure, the quality such as straight-through occur hidden
Suffer from.Magnetic switch is designed using constructive interference more for this, tongue tube is effectively supported in magnetic switch, so as to improve note
Mould accuracy and improve processing efficiency.
The magnetic approach switch structure as disclosed in Unexamined Patent 7-262893, includes housing, tongue tube and disengaging lead,
Locating support is equipped with the injection molding cavity of housing, locating support both ends have cable clamping interface, and the both ends of tongue tube are drawn pin and blocked respectively
It is connected on cable clamping interface, disengaging lead is respectively welded on two pins of tongue tube, and line outlet groove is offered in the one side wall of housing,
Disengaging lead is pierced by and fixes from line outlet groove, and fluid sealant is poured into the injection molding cavity of housing.Showa 56-22744 discloses one kind
The fixed connection structure of tongue tube pin, difference are that tongue tube pin is connected on end plate, and end plate is riveted on substrate,
Lead and the tongue tube pin at substrate both ends weld.
Such scheme positions purpose mainly for fixation of the tongue tube in glue box and encapsulating, does not take into full account dry spring
The connection structure stability of pipe and lead, the weatherability and less reliable of magnetic switch.Therefore, the prior art needs to change
Into and development.
